Revision: 8370
Author: xqt
Date: 2010-07-29 08:11:42 +0000 (Thu, 29 Jul 2010)
Log Message:
-----------
Localization fixes by harriv (patch request bug #3035508). Thanks.
Modified Paths:
--------------
trunk/pywikipedia/archivebot.py
Modified: trunk/pywikipedia/archivebot.py
===================================================================
--- trunk/pywikipedia/archivebot.py 2010-07-29 07:22:06 UTC (rev 8369)
+++ trunk/pywikipedia/archivebot.py 2010-07-29 08:11:42 UTC (rev 8370)
@@ -155,10 +155,10 @@
'OlderThanSummary': u'äldre än',
},
'fi': {
- 'ArchiveFull' : u'(ARCHIVE FULL)',
+ 'ArchiveFull' : u'(ARKISTO TÄYSI)',
'InitialArchiveHeader': u'{{arkisto}}',
'PageSummary': u'Arkistoidaan %(count)d keskustelua (%(why)s)
%(archives)s arkistoon.',
- 'ArchiveSummary': u'Arkistoidaan %(count)d keskutelua sivulta
[[%(from)s]].',
+ 'ArchiveSummary': u'Arkistoidaan %(count)d keskustelua sivulta
[[%(from)s]].',
'OlderThanSummary': u'vanhempi kuin',
},
}
@@ -223,7 +223,8 @@
def int2month_short(num):
"""Returns the locale's abbreviated name of month 'num'
(1-12)."""
if hasattr(locale, 'nl_langinfo'):
- return locale.nl_langinfo(locale.ABMON_1+num-1).replace('\xa0',
'').decode('utf-8')
+ #filter out non-alpha characters
+ return ''.join([c for c in
locale.nl_langinfo(locale.ABMON_1+num-1).decode('utf-8') if c.isalpha()])
Months = ['jan', 'feb', 'mar', 'apr', 'may',
'jun',
'jul', 'aug', 'sep', 'oct', 'nov',
'dec']
return Site.mediawiki_message(Months[num-1])
Show replies by date